Rear-end collisions

A rear-end collision is a kind of accident that occurs when a car crashes into the rear of another vehicle. These crashes can be quite dangerous. They can result in a large number of injuries and death as well as significant property damage.

There are many reasons why rear-end collisions can happen. The most frequent causes include speeding, tailgating, or distracted driving. If you're a victim of a rear-end accident you should protect your legal rights and seek compensation from the negligent person who caused your injuries.

In the majority of instances, rear-end collisions occur when a driver is unable to slow down sufficiently or stop completely in time. This is usually caused by drivers who are texting or listening to music on their phones.

Rear-end collisions can be exacerbated by the size of the truck and weight. Heavy trucks, such tractor-trailers as well as other heavy vehicles can weigh up to an 80,000-pound weight. They take longer to stop than passenger vehicles.

Due to these reasons the majority of victims of truck accidents suffer life-threatening injuries. They may suffer brain injuries and spinal cord injuries, herniated discs, fractured bones and other severe ailments.

It is important to seek medical attention immediately if you have been in an accident that involved the rear end of a truck. Whiplash injuries can cause pain, stiffness, and limited movement in the neck and upper body.

Also, you should document all details regarding your rear-end truck accident. This includes where you were at the time of the accident and who was at fault and what happened during the crash. This information can be used to support your claim.

Head-on collisions

A head-on collision occurs when two cars collide front-to-back when they travel in opposite directions. This is not something that should happen on a highway and head-on collisions with trucks are especially risky due to the weight and size of trucks.

A head-on collision may be caused by driver error , or other causes. The most common cause is when a vehicle is in its lane and crosses into the oncoming traffic. This can happen due to a variety of reasons, such as driver distractions caused by objects or animals on the road , or even driving when impaired.

In the same way, speeding by drivers can contribute to head-on accidents. Larger trucks can easily drift out of their lane travel at higher speeds, making it easier for them to cause a head-on collision.

A person could be entitled to compensation if they suffer serious injuries during an accident that involves head-on. In some states, victims are able to file an action even if they are partly at fault for the crash. This is known as a state with an element of comparative fault.

Side-swipe collisions

Side-swipe collisions may be very minimal or extremely dangerous based on the circumstances and the vehicles involved. Broken bones, traumatic head trauma, upper-thorax trauma, and internal injuries are all possible.

Sideswipe accidents can happen when a vehicle takes an unsafe turn or changes lanes. Before changing lanes, drivers should inspect their mirrors and blind spots, particularly when they are driving high clearance trucks.

Road conditions can cause sideswipe collisions. For instance when a driver changes lanes on wet or icy roads, they may not be able to discern the traffic coming towards them and may hit another vehicle in the same lanes.

If you are involved in a collision involving a sideswipe be sure to report the accident immediately. It may be difficult to obtain compensation for injuries you sustained in an accident if do not report it promptly.

Documenting the scene of the collision can help prove negligence. Take pictures of the accident scene from every angle and take pictures of any impressions left on the road or other items.

Keep track of all medical bills and expenses incurred as a result. These expenses could include hospitalization, emergency care and doctor visits, medications and medical equipment, long-term treatment, and more.

T-bone collisions

T-bone collisions, also referred to as broadside impacts, are particularly hazardous for passengers in cars struck by truck. A vehicle's side offers little protection to its passengers so anyone in a truck-truck collision could sustain serious injuries, or even die.

These crashes typically occur when drivers do not give other drivers the right of way or recklessly drive through red lights. Additionally many T-bone accidents are caused by poor timing of traffic signals or poor road design.

Trucks are more likely to be in a side-impact collision due to their size and weight than regular passenger vehicles. Contact an attorney for personal injuries immediately when you've been injured in a T-bone accident.

Those who are hurt in T-bone collisions can seek compensation for their losses from the parties who caused the accident. This could include the driver responsible for the crash, their employer, as well as the manufacturer or model of the commercial truck.

Rollover collisions

Truck rollovers are a dangerous type of collision because they can result in the death or serious injury to the driver. They can also cause damage or injury to other vehicles and lead to long traffic jams which can be dangerous.

Most rollovers happen when the vehicle is unable to control itself, either due to road conditions or an issue with the vehicle itself. These issues can be caused by the driver, other motorists, equipment, or a combination thereof.

The main cause of rollovers is likely speed. Large trucks have a large center of gravity. A truck that is operating too fast for the road could shift the weight onto the chassis, resulting in a rollover.

A cargo that's not properly secured is a common cause of rollovers. This can be a cause for cargo that is too heavy, poorly fastened, or positioned too high in the albuquerque truck accident lawyers.

The risk of rollovers caused by load can be reduced despite the risk. This can be accomplished by taking care to secure the load properly and ensuring it is secure prior to drive.

The truck's length can also impact the risk of an overturn. Trucks that are shorter have lower centers of gravity, making them less likely to tip over than those with longer lengths.
